An open lecture on still life was held at the Department of Fine Arts.
On September 22, an open lecture for students “Laws of Composition and Perspective in Graphic Still Life” was held by Inna Hurzhii, a senior lecturer at the Department of Fine Arts, a member of the National Union of Artists of Ukraine.
The lecture was divided into three parts. In the first theoretical component, the history and essence of graphic still life as one of the genres of fine art was told using multimedia tools: examples of works by famous artists were shown, the origin of the names of this genre was explained, etc. After that, the students listened carefully to Ms. Inna, who explained in detail the process of working on a still life in the drawing technique: perspective, horizon line, chiaroscuro, and the like. The last part was the task of using the acquired knowledge in practice and trying to finish their own still life in 30 minutes based on the objects already exhibited in front of the students.
